    • The 2019–2020 Hong Kong protests (also known by other names) were a series of demonstrations against the Hong Kong government's introduction of a bill to amend the Fugitive Offenders Ordinance in regard to extradition.     DateEntire movement: · Since 15 March 2019 · Large-scale break-out: · 9 June 2019 – mid-2020 · Protests begin to diminish in scale in early 2020 due to the COVID-19 pandemic in Hong Kong · The Hong Kong government declares that most street demonstrations have ceased since the Hong Kong national security law came into effect in mid-2020
    LocationHong Kong (solidarity protests worldwide)
    Caused byIntroduction of the Fugitive Offenders and Mutual Legal Assistance in Criminal Matters Legislation (Amendment) Bill 2019 · Alleged misconduct by the Hong Kong Police Force against protesters (since 12 June 2019) · Tensions between Hong Kong and mainland China, political screening, economic and social inequality · Failure of the 2014 Umbrella Revolution
    GoalsFive Demands · Full withdrawal of the extradition bill · Retraction of the characterisation of protests as "riots" · Release and exoneration of arrested protesters · Establishment of an independent commission of inquiry into police behaviour · Resignation of Carrie Lam and universal suffrage for the Legislative Council and the chief executive elections
